CAUTION
At washing, if welding point of cable
gets rust because water inflow,
starting can not be done.
At washing, if water inflows to the
muffler, the muffler gets rust early
and damaged that may cause bad
starting.
If washing by strong alcohol
detergent, it may cause the lamps and
plastic parts being damaged or
discolored.

Make sure to stop the engine prior to
vehicle.
Be careful not to allow water to enter
the muffler during the washing.Water
inside the muffler may cause an
improper engine starting or rust
occurrence.
Do not let water get inside the braking
system during the washing, as water
inside the brake system may weaken
the braking power. Upon completion of
washing, select a safe place where
there is no traffic obstruction, and start
the vehicle.
Lightly apply the brake while driving
at a slow speed and check the braking
power. If the braking power has been
weak-ened, apply brake lightly while
driving at a slow speed to dry up the
brake system.
Take precautions when waxing the
vehicle. Excessive polish of the painted
section and/or the resin part with
compound wax might damage the
painted section causing discoloration of
the affected area.
At washing, be careful for water not to
flow into the trunk(luggage box). At
inflowing, the valuable things inside
trunk can be wet.
